NettetInstallation of Bollards. Layout the desired location for the bollard placement and mark the ground at the approximate center point. Dig a hole using a post hole digger. The diameter of the hole should be the diameter of the bollard plus 6 inches and it should be 18 to 24 inches deep. Nettet25. apr. 2024 · Check for underground cables. At the bottom, you'll install gravel and a rebar cage to facilitate moisture drainage and reinforce the bollard. NettetBollard Installation Specifications. 6″ Schedule 40 Steel Pipe, Quantity 20. Each pipe is 96″ long, with 48″ above grade and 48″ below grade in footing. Concrete is at least 3500 psi and fills pipe and footing. Concrete Footing has an 18″ diameter and goes 48″ deep.
